I will always be looking for you: A Queer Anthology on Arab Art archiving to cephalopods and seeking aI Will Always Be Looking For You A Queer Anthology on Arab Art gathers the works of 31 artists from 13 Arabic speaking countries, with literary contributions by 24 commissioned writers from across the region and its diaspora. The writing spans a wide range of genrespoetry, essays, fiction, experimental texteach in direct dialogue with the visual artwork it accompanies. Together, the works document and expand the definition of queerness in the Arab
